Gymnastikz Unlimited-Jenison ($5/session):
Fridays: 6:30-8:30 pm
Saturdays: 1-3 pm

Aerials & Baranis-Near Me, Plainfield and Northland area ($10/session):
Fridays: 1-3 pm and 6:30-8:30 pm, also a 13 and up open session from 9-10:30, only $7, 30 minutes shorter than normal session. I'd like to try this one out because there's no little kids to worry about, ha ha, but might be hard with my schedule.
Saturdays: 7-10 pm (3 hrs rather than 2), cost is still $10, so good deal. This one might be busy because it's a little different, but maybe not. Haven't tried it yet.

Born to Flip/Horizon Complex-Jenison ($5/session):
Saturdays: 1-3 pm


NOTE: The top 2 I've gone too, mostly the first one. Second one would be great, even though it's $5 more. $10 may be a little on the high side but it's still not bad compared to a lot of gyms from what I've heard. More available gym times too, plus that Teen Night thing. G.U. is a good one to fall back on though for times and overall price. Only thing is it can be a bit hard with people in the way. Sometimes it's really empty though on Saturdays, so it's not bad.

Last one I haven't visited yet, but that's the info I gathered from their site. I'll probably check it out sometime and see if it's not too small or whatever.

There is another in Wyoming area but they don't have a reasonable plyo floor. The only thing I could make use of there for tricking was a long tumble track to work on moves that go in a straight line. Forget doing various combos, kicks or whatever else though that might go all over the place. Simply no room, so I don't even consider that on option for a group. I sometimes go there to work on a few select moves by myself.

Haha well breaks off tricking can be helpful. Two weeks is nothing. The last 2 or 3 years during the winter time I did little to no tricking for 3-4 months straight. I mean...not even once a month sometimes. When I got back into it I noticed some improvements in areas, but general technique lacked in others. I guess it can be helpful and harmful, but that's why I'm not afraid to take a lot of time off it even if I'm uninjured. You might slip back a bit but it doesn't take long to get back up to where you were and go further, seeing as it's all stuff you've done before. To me, breaks do help you physically but more than anything, it's mental. You can learn a lot even when you aren't tricking through study and you tend to lose bad habits you had formed and whatnot. Of course, you might create new ones too but it's worth the risk when the pros outweigh the cons.

Though I haven't been very dedicated with it before, I plan on tricking full force throughout good weather this year, make the most progress possible and either eliminate it or do so very rarely in the winter to focus on other aspects of training (mostly lifting haha), then restart in the spring. It was a plan for this year until I met you guys of course, then I just HAD to focus on tricking again. Point is, it's going to rough at first coming back after months off but it won't hurt me that much, and seeing as I'll have improved physically elsewhere, it'll help with my tricking.

As I conversed with you before, it's quite hard to jumble both together, and I mean when trying to do each to the best of your ability. Something has to come down for both to work, and that kind of training doesn't suit me.
